What is the oxidation number of n in NO2F?

The oxidation number of oxygen is typically -2, and the oxidation number of fluorine is -1. Since the overall molecule NO2F has a neutral charge, we can set up the equation x + 2(-2) + (-1) = 0 to solve for the oxidation number of nitrogen. This gives us x = +4, indicating that the oxidation number of nitrogen in NO2F is +4.

Does CaCO3 have a Lewis structure?

No, not exactly. It is an ionic compound so it would not have a Lewis dot structure. However, the carbonate anion, CO3^2- does have a Lewis dot structure.

When was Lewis structure created?

The Lewis structure was created by American chemist Gilbert N. Lewis in 1916. Lewis proposed using dots to represent the valence electrons of an atom in order to show how atoms bond together in molecules.
